Output 66f3e94f14e4f1301bf9ddde6d599c5a195f728bf5d9dba4209929efcd968fd3:0

value
7698407
script pubkey
OP_0 OP_PUSHBYTES_20 1cd121d867895652ed64380eb63b22a1253e92c7
address
bc1qrngjrkr839t99mty8q8tvwez5yjnayk852etnd
transaction
66f3e94f14e4f1301bf9ddde6d599c5a195f728bf5d9dba4209929efcd968fd3
confirmations
131247
spent
true